Ericsson, Qualcomm Demonstrate 63 Mbps Downlink with 3G HSDPA

Turkcell, Ericsson and Qualcomm have successfully demoed the live 3-Carrier High-Speed Downlink Packet Access (3C-HSDPA) on a commercial network. The test utilized a feature that will be included in Ericsson’s software release 15A and was conducted on a smartphone powered by a Qualcomm processor with its integrated Qualcommmodem.

Orange Launches LTE Service in Slovakia

Orange Slovakia has launched LTE network in country. Operator’s LTE service is currently available in Bratislava, Kosice and Banska Bystrica.  Orange plans to cover 30 percent of the Slovak population with LTE by the end of year. 

ZTE Proposes Pre-5G Concept for 4G Terminals

ZTE has introduced its first pre-5G concept. At the LTE World Summit 2014 in Nice, France, ZTE announced that under certain conditions some 5G technologies can provide a 5G-like user experience on 4G terminals without changing the air interface standards. 

Zain KSA to Invest $1.2 Billion in Network Infrastructure

Zain Saudi Arabia (Zain KSA) has signed network expansion and upgrade agreements worth US $1.2 billion with five technology companies: Huawei, Nokia, NEC, Cisco, and Alcatel Lucent. The agreements aim to enhance Zain KSA’s customer experience and to improve and expand Zain’s network capacity, coverage and speed.
